I like the Visoflex 2 EZVF for Leica M11 and always have it on mine. It's great for focusing close up or with telephoto lenses, and for precise composition with wideangle lenses. Optical viewfinders are OK for distance composition, but increas in inaccuracy the closer your subject gets to the camera. They were a necessity for wide lenses on film rangefinders, but I find them very frustrating on cameras that can take an EVF.
